Economy & Jobs
The median household income in Monte Grande comunidad is $27,417, 64% below the national average of $75,149. The unemployment rate of 5.9% is somewhat elevated compared to the national rate of 3.6%. The poverty rate of 30.7% exceeds the national average of 12.4%, indicating economic hardship for a significant portion of the population. Workers commute an average of 36 minutes, longer than the typical American commute of 28 minutes.
Cost of Living & Housing
The median home value in Monte Grande comunidad is $108,900, 61% below the national median — offering relatively affordable homeownership. Renters pay a median of $484 per month, below the national average — a plus for affordability. A price-to-income ratio of 4x indicates a reasonably affordable housing market.
